与.js文件

时间:2016-10-01 17:37:32

标签: html angularjs

我是Angular JS的新手。我正在尝试一个简单的例子,但似乎没有用。

我使用以下代码创建了一个script.js: -

var myApp = angular.module(“myModule”,[])。controller(“myController”,function($ scope){     $ scope.message =“AngularJS教程”; });

和HtmlPage1.html: -

<script src="Script.js"></script>
 <script src="Scripts/angular.min.js"></script> </head> <body>
 <div ng-app="myModule">
     <div ng-controller="myController">
         {{ message }}
     </div>
 </div> 

但是我得到了这个结果: -

{{message}}

我不知道出了什么问题。请帮忙......

2 个答案:

答案 0 :(得分:0)

加载Script.js的引用后加载angular.js,因为模块声明需要angular的引用。

您需要做的是确保在尝试在其上注册控制器之前创建角度模块。

<script src="Scripts/angular.min.js"></script>  
<script src="Script.js"></script>

DEMO

答案 1 :(得分:0)

<script src="Scripts/angular.min.js"></script>
<script src="Script.js"></script> </head> <body>
<div ng-app="myModule">
 <div ng-controller="myController">
     {{ message }}
 </div>
</div> 

在角度库(y)之后包含控制器